Early Examples and Pioneers
The first real-world trials of digital passports have been promising. Finland, for example, launched a pilot project allowing travelers between Helsinki and London to use digital credentials. Australia and New Zealand have also explored ways to integrate biometrics into their immigration systems, setting the stage for a broader rollout soon.
Private companies and tech developers are collaborating with government agencies to ensure data encryption, privacy protection, and secure verification methods. These collaborations highlight the growing momentum behind creating a globally recognized digital passport system.

Challenges Facing Digital Passport Adoption
While the vision is inspiring, there are still significant hurdles to overcome before digital passports become mainstream.
- Privacy and Data Protection
With sensitive personal information stored electronically, there is a justified concern over potential hacking, surveillance, and misuse of data. Governments must ensure robust cybersecurity frameworks and transparent regulations to build public trust.
- International Standardization
For digital passports to work globally, there must be agreement on technical standards, data formats, and recognition across different countries. Negotiating these standards among hundreds of nations with varying laws and systems presents a formidable challenge.
- Accessibility and Equity
Not everyone owns a smartphone or has consistent access to digital services. To ensure fairness, traditional passports would likely remain available for many years, running parallel to digital options until universal accessibility is feasible.
